<p>Assessment of axillary lymph node status is an integral part of management of patients with invasive and some patients with in situ cancer of the mammary gland. This guide describes the rationale of axillary evaluation, extent of axillary surgery, and sampling to modern sentinel node mapping employing different tracers. The trainee surgical residents and young surgeons would find it very useful for day to day management of patient with breast cancer. Fluorescein sodium is emerging as a new affordable tracer for sentinel node mapping.</p>
